High Levels of Anonymity on Telegram

One of the primary reasons scammers flock to Telegram is the platform's high level of anonymity. Unlike other social media platforms, where users are often required to verify their identity with personal information, Telegram allows more freedom. This characteristic creates an inviting environment for malicious actors. Let's break down how anonymity plays a significant role in scamming activities:

  • No Phone Number Verification: While Telegram encourages users to sign up using a phone number, it offers options to hide or obscure this information. Scammers can easily create multiple accounts using disposable numbers, making it challenging to trace their activities back to a single individual.
  • Username Functionality: Telegram allows users to set up usernames that can be used instead of phone numbers. This means users don’t need to share personal information, which scammers can manipulate to contact victims without revealing their true identity.
  • End-to-End Encryption: Telegram boasts encryption features that protect messages from prying eyes. While this is advantageous for privacy, it also means that scammers can communicate without fear of interception, making it hard for law enforcement to track illicit activities.
  • Group Chats and Channels: Scammers often create large groups or channels that can reach thousands of users. These platforms are typically public or labeled as “anonymous,” allowing scammers to advertise their schemes without fear of being identified by victims or authorities.

The atmosphere of anonymity creates an illusion of safety for users, and scammers exploit this to set up elaborate schemes, ranging from fake investments to phishing attacks. For instance, someone might join a crypto investment group, lured by promises of high returns, only to find themselves the target of a sophisticated con.

Furthermore, the decentralized nature of Telegram means that even if one account gets shut down, a scammer can quickly create a new one and resume their activities without significant interruption. This cat-and-mouse game makes it tough for law enforcement to tackle the issue effectively. By leveraging these anonymity features, scammers are not only able to operate successfully but also adapt and change their methods, keeping potential victims unaware and unprepared.

3. Features of Telegram that Attract Scammers

When it comes to messaging apps, Telegram stands out for a variety of reasons. However, these very features also make it a magnet for scammers. Let’s explore what makes Telegram such an appealing playground for malicious activities.

End-to-End Encryption: One of the major selling points of Telegram is its robust security features. While Telegram does offer end-to-end encryption in its Secret Chats, it might not be as widely adopted in regular chats. This creates an illusion of safety and confidentiality, giving scammers the upper hand to operate without fear of being monitored.

Anonymous Accounts: Telegram allows users to sign up with just a phone number, and they can choose to keep their phone number private from others. This anonymity is particularly attractive for scammers, as it makes it easier for them to hide their identities. They can create multiple accounts, jump from one to another, and evade detection without much effort.

Channel and Bot Abilities: Telegram's channels and bots provide unique avenues for scammers to reach a large audience. Channels enable scammers to broadcast messages to thousands of users, making it easy to spread misinformation or promote fraudulent schemes. Bots, on the other hand, can automate interactions and scams, allowing malicious actors to engage with multiple victims simultaneously, reducing the amount of effort needed to execute fraudulent operations.

Increased Group Engagement: Telegram supports large group chats, which can include thousands of members. Scammers often exploit these groups by creating a false sense of community. By engaging users in discussions or promoting "exclusive" offers, they can better manipulate individuals. This peer pressure and social validation can lead people to take risky actions they otherwise wouldn’t.

Seamless File Sharing: Telegram allows users to send files up to 2 GB at a time, making it easier for scammers to share fraudulent documents, fake receipts, or even malicious software. This capability enhances their ability to deceive potential victims by providing seemingly legitimate proof of their scams.

While these features contribute to Telegram's popularity, they also create an environment ripe for scams. It’s essential for users to be aware of these characteristics and exercise caution when interacting with unknown accounts or channels.

4. Global Reach and Accessibility of Telegram

Telegram has exploded in popularity around the globe, and this global reach significantly benefits scammers. With millions of users spread across different countries, scammers can easily target a diverse range of individuals. Here are some reasons why Telegram's accessibility makes it appealing for those with dishonest intentions.

Multi-Language Support: Telegram supports a wide array of languages, making it accessible to users in virtually any part of the world. This diverse linguistic feature allows scammers to reach non-English speakers, tailoring their scams to fit local cultures and languages. By speaking the victim’s language, they can build trust and credibility much faster.

Availability in Restricted Regions: In countries where other social media platforms are banned or heavily monitored, Telegram often remains accessible. Scammers can take advantage of this situation to reach users who might otherwise be less exposed to traditional social media scams. This accessibility opens up new markets for fraudulent activities.

Cross-Platform Compatibility: Whether it's on a smartphone, tablet, or desktop, Telegram is available across multiple platforms. This omni-accessibility means that users can connect to their scams at any time and from anywhere. Scammers can easily switch between devices, making tracking their activities even more difficult for law enforcement.

Viral Nature of Content: Because Telegram allows users to forward messages to others with just a simple tap, false information and scams can spread like wildfire. A single fraudulent message shared in one group can quickly reach thousands of users, creating opportunities for scammers to exploit many people simultaneously.

As we can see, the global reach and accessibility of Telegram make it a lucrative platform for scammers. Recognizing these factors can help users remain vigilant and better protect themselves from potential scams.

5. Limited Regulation and Oversight on Messaging Apps

One of the primary reasons scammers are drawn to Telegram is the limited regulation and oversight associated with messaging apps compared to traditional financial platforms. Unlike banks and established financial services, which are strictly monitored and mandated to follow regulatory protocols, messaging apps operate in a much more decentralized and less scrutinized environment.

This lack of oversight means that scammers can operate with relative anonymity. They can create accounts, communicate with victims, and conduct scams without the same level of scrutiny that they'd face on regulated platforms. Here are a few factors contributing to this:

  • Anonymity: Telegram allows users to sign up with just a phone number, providing minimal identification requirements. This makes it easy for scammers to create multiple accounts without the risk of being tracked.
  • End-to-End Encryption: Telegram's promise of enhanced privacy and encryption enhances its appeal. While this feature protects users from prying eyes, it also shields scammers from law enforcement, making it challenging to trace their activities.
  • Decentralized Nature: Being a globally operated messaging app, Telegram operates across various jurisdictions. This decentralized nature complicates law enforcement efforts, as different countries have different rules and regulations.

Moreover, when scams do occur, the response and resolution can be significantly hampered by the app’s inherent structure. Many users may not know how to report scams or where to seek help, leaving them vulnerable to future incidents. As a result, the combination of low barriers to entry, enhanced privacy features, and minimal regulatory frameworks creates a perfect storm that scammers exploit.

6. Case Studies: Notable Scams on Telegram

While talking about scams on Telegram, understanding some real-life instances can provide insight into how these schemes operate and why they're effective. Here are a few notable scams that have taken place on the platform:

Scam NameDescriptionOutcome
Fake Investment SchemesScammers create groups that promote high-return investment opportunities in cryptocurrency. They lure users with promises of massive returns, often using fake testimonials.Many individuals lose significant sums of money, as the scammers disappear once funds are transferred.
Lottery ScamsScammers send messages claiming recipients have won a lottery or prize but must pay a 'processing fee' to claim it.Victims are cheated out of their money, and the scammers continue to collect personal information.
Romance ScamsScammers pose as romantic interests, building relationships and eventually asking for money under various pretenses.Victims often suffer emotional and financial damage, as they invest time and money into fake relationships.

These case studies highlight the diverse tactics scammers use on Telegram, exploiting the platform’s features to their advantage. Users often find themselves in these precarious situations, unaware of the red flags associated with these scams.

7. How to Protect Yourself from Scams on Telegram

Staying safe on Telegram requires a mix of awareness, skepticism, and practical measures. Here are some essential tips to help you protect yourself from potential scams:

  • Enable Privacy Settings: Dive into the privacy settings of your Telegram account. Make sure your profile is set to visible only to your contacts and restrict who can find you via your phone number.
  • Beware of Unknown Links: If you receive a message from someone you don’t recognize containing links or attachments, think twice before clicking. Scammers often use phishing links to steal your personal information.
  • Don’t Share Personal Information: Refrain from sharing sensitive details like your address, financial information, or passwords, especially with individuals or groups you don't trust completely.
  • Verify Contacts: If someone approaches you with a business proposal or investment opportunity, do your homework! Check their profile, look for signs of legitimacy, and verify their identity through independent channels.
  • Report Suspicious Activity: If you encounter a scam or suspicious activity, report it to Telegram. They have mechanisms in place to handle these reports and take action against culprits.
  • Use Two-Factor Authentication: Activate two-factor authentication (2FA) on your Telegram account. This adds an extra layer of security, making it more difficult for scammers to gain access to your account.
  • Educate Yourself: Stay informed about common scams and how they operate. Knowledge is your first line of defense, so follow tech blogs, news sites, or social media for updates on emerging threats.

By taking these proactive steps, you can significantly lower your chances of falling victim to scams on Telegram. Remember, being cautious and informed is essential in the digital world!
